This former Roman castle from the 13th century is named after knight Gheeraert van Ghent, nicknamed the Devil. Of the 13de-centurial construction from Doornikse limestone, only are kept still the east wing and the donjon. From the 14d century this castle was property of the city. Since start 20th century the National archives is here established. Only the reading hall is to visit for consultation of the archives.
